「Vibe Coding」風潮下,AI 生成的程式碼為何需要程式碼審查(Code Review)?
Answer
「Vibe Coding」趨勢下程式碼審查的必要性
隨著「Vibe Coding」風潮興起,AI 生成程式碼的品質變得參差不齊,這使得程式碼審查(Code Review)的重要性日益凸顯。諸如 GitHub Copilot 等 AI 工具被廣泛應用於程式碼撰寫,雖然提高了效率,但也產生了大量潛在錯誤的程式碼。傳統的程式碼審查流程難以應付這種情況,因此出現了像 CodeRabbit 這樣的新創公司,專注於提供 AI 輔助的程式碼審查工具,以應對這一挑戰。
CodeRabbit 的崛起與市場洞察
CodeRabbit 在這波趨勢中迅速崛起,專注於解決 AI 生成程式碼品質不一的問題。該公司成立僅兩年,便完成了由 Scale Venture Partners 領投的 6,000 萬美元 B 輪募資,公司估值達到 5.5 億美元。目前,CodeRabbit 已吸引超過 5,000 家付費企業客戶,年營收(ARR)突破 1,500 萬美元,並以每月雙位數的速度持續增長。創辦人兼執行長 Harjot Gill 觀察到工程師大量使用 AI 工具生成程式碼的趨勢,意識到程式碼審查將成為一個關鍵問題。
創辦人的策略轉型與市場機會
Harjot Gill 認為,AI 雖然提高了寫程式的效率,但產出的程式碼品質不一,需要耗費大量人力進行修正與審查。因此,他決定將原本的新創 FluxNinja 轉型,專注於提供 AI 輔助的程式碼審查工具,成功抓住了市場機會。這種策略轉型不僅反映了對市場趨勢的敏銳洞察,也顯示了 CodeRabbit 在應對 AI 程式碼挑戰方面的創新能力。